A Missed Engagement: A Pride and Prejudice Variation by Sophia Grey, A Lady
On a dark winter night, flames light the sky. Longbourn is burning.

After an impossible tragedy, Elizabeth Bennet and her family are forced to depend upon the kindness of their neighbors. Mr. Charles Bingley, newly arrived to Hertfordshire, will not hear any word against his wish that the Bennets should stay at Netherfield Park for the approaching Christmas festivities.

Overwhelmed by Mr. Bingley’s generosity, Elizabeth’s joy in the season is only marred by the presence of a gentleman who does not seem to share his friend’s sentiments. But an unexpected proposal leaves Elizabeth questioning how much she really knows about herself, and the disagreeable gentleman who has made the request.

Will a practical marriage outweigh the possibility that she might be forced to make a decision that will take her even farther away from the very deepest love she has always hoped to discover? Or is a convenient marriage the only way to achieve that which might have otherwise eluded her? If an agreement can be struck, perhaps both parties will be satisfied with their arrangement.

A Missed Engagement is a sweet, clean Pride and Prejudice variation that is suitable for all lovers of Jane Austen’s classic love story.
